The Open-Q™ 8550CS is a high-performing System on Module by Lantronix based on Qualcomm® Dragonwing™ QCS8550 SOC.  It provides a performance level of 48 INT8, 12 FP16 TOPs, which meets the higher AI/ML requirements for extreme edge computing, incl. various Edge devices, Edge servers, and Edge AI boxes. 

Powered by Qualcomm Dragonwing™ QCS8550, the Open-Q 8550CS offers low power consumption with a 4nm process, maximum heterogeneous computing, an 8th-generation AI Engine delivering 10x performance over the previous generation, enterprise-level connectivity with Wi-Fi 7 (supporting up to 5.8Gbps), and best-in-class performance across compute processing, camera, AI, security, and audio. 

Its use cases and applications include multi-camera and camera systems, Edge AI gateways, video collaboration, cloud gaming, industrial drones, and more.

Key Features
  • Based on Qualcomm® 8550 SoC
  • Up to 16GB LPDDR5 RAM + 128GB UFS Flash
  • Android™ 13 and Linux Yocto Kirkstone
  • On-device AI Engine with Qualcomm Hexagon™ Tensor Processor (HTP)
  • Dedicated Computer Vision Engine
  • Multiple MIPI camera and display ports
  • Multiple high speed connectivity options
  • TAA and NDAA compliant (at least 10 years of longevity for the Open-Q 8550CS)
